December 4, 2023I am grateful for the friends I’ve made through my advocacy efforts as your State Representative. This past weekend, I was invited to serve as a panelist at the Connecticut Association of the Deaf's (CAD) Legislative 101 Workshop that took place at the American School for the Deaf. CAD President Luisa Soboleski is a resident and member of Southington’s Deaf, DeafBlind, and Hard of Hearing Community.
